首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

服务中找不到mysql的服务

当您在服务中找不到MySQL的服务时,可能是由于以下几个原因造成的:

基础概念

MySQL是一种关系型数据库管理系统(RDBMS),它使用SQL(结构化查询语言)进行数据管理。MySQL服务是指运行在服务器上的MySQL数据库实例,它允许应用程序通过客户端连接来访问和管理数据库。

可能的原因

  1. 服务未安装:MySQL数据库可能没有安装在您的服务器上。
  2. 服务未启动:即使安装了MySQL,服务也可能因为某些原因没有启动。
  3. 服务名称错误:在不同的操作系统或配置中,MySQL服务的名称可能有所不同。
  4. 权限问题:当前用户可能没有足够的权限来查看或启动MySQL服务。

解决方法

检查MySQL是否安装

首先,确认MySQL是否已经安装在您的系统上。可以通过以下命令检查:

代码语言:txt
复制
mysql --version

如果MySQL已安装,您将看到版本信息。如果没有安装,您需要先进行安装。

启动MySQL服务

如果MySQL已安装但服务未启动,您可以尝试启动服务。以下是在不同操作系统中启动MySQL服务的命令:

  • Windows:
  • Windows:
  • 或者在服务管理器中查找MySQL服务并启动。
  • Linux (使用systemd):
  • Linux (使用systemd):
  • Linux (使用init.d):
  • Linux (使用init.d):

检查服务状态

您可以使用以下命令检查MySQL服务的状态:

  • Windows:
  • Windows:
  • Linux (使用systemd):
  • Linux (使用systemd):
  • Linux (使用init.d):
  • Linux (使用init.d):

安装MySQL

如果MySQL未安装,您需要根据您的操作系统进行安装。以下是在Ubuntu上安装MySQL的示例:

代码语言:txt
复制
sudo apt update
sudo apt install mysql-server

设置开机自启动

为了确保MySQL服务在系统重启后自动启动,您可以设置开机自启动:

  • Windows: 在服务管理器中将MySQL服务的启动类型设置为“自动”。
  • Linux (使用systemd):
  • Linux (使用systemd):

应用场景

MySQL广泛应用于各种Web应用程序、企业信息系统、数据分析等领域。它的优势包括高性能、稳定性、易用性和广泛的社区支持。

类型

MySQL有多种版本,包括社区版和企业版。社区版是免费的,适合大多数用户;企业版提供更多高级功能和支持。

相关优势

  • 开源:MySQL是一个开源项目,可以免费使用。
  • 跨平台:支持多种操作系统。
  • 高性能:优化了查询处理,适合高负载应用。
  • 安全性:提供了多种安全特性,如加密连接和访问控制。

通过以上步骤,您应该能够解决服务中找不到MySQL服务的问题。如果问题仍然存在,可能需要进一步检查日志文件或联系技术支持以获取帮助。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

重启MySQL服务(怎么重启mysql服务)

一、MYSQL服务 我的电脑——(右键)管理——服务与应用程序——服务——MYSQL——开启(停止、重启动) 二、命令行方式 Windows 1.点击“开始”->“运行”(快捷键Win+R)。...-04-30┆379,578 Views┆56,071 错误编号:1040 问题分析: 连接数超过了 MySQL 设置的值,与 max_connections 和 wait_timeout 都有关系。...wait_timeout 的值越大,连接的空闲等待就越长,这样就会造成当前连接数越大。...解决方法: 1、虚拟主机用户请联系空间商优化 MySQL 服务器的配置; 2、独立主机用户请联系服务器管理员优化 MySQL 服务器的配置,可参考: 修改 MySQL 配置文件(Windows下为 my.ini..., Linux下为 my.cnf )中的参数: CODE: [COPY] max_connections= 1000 wait_timeout = 5 发布者:全栈程序员栈长,转载请注明出处:https

12.5K30
  • 微服务架构中的服务发现

    在运行在物理硬件上的传统应用中,服务实例的网络位置是相对静态的。例如,您的代码可以从偶尔更新的配置文件读取网络位置。 然而,在现代的基于云的微服务应用中,这是一个更难解决的问题,如下图所示。 ?...您不需要为开发人员使用的每种编程语言和框架实现服务注册逻辑。相反,在专用服务中以集中的方式处理服务实例注册。...这种模式的一个缺点是,除非内置到部署环境中,否则它是另一个高可用性的系统组件,您需要进行设置和管理。 总结 在微服务应用程序中,运行的服务实例集会动态更改。实例具有动态分配的网络位置。...在使用客户端服务发现的系统中,客户端查询服务注册表,选择可用实例并发出请求。在使用服务器端发现的系统中,客户端通过路由器发出请求,路由器查询服务注册表并将请求转发到可用的实例。...在某些部署环境中,您需要使用Netflix Eureka,etcd或Apache Zookeeper等服务注册表设置自己的服务发现基础设施。在其他部署环境中,内置服务发现。

    2.2K80

    linux命令mysql启动,在linux中启动mysql服务的命令

    在图形界面下启动mysql服务的步骤如下: (1)打开控制面板->管理工具->服务,如下图所示: 可以看到Mysql服务目前的状态是未启动(未写已启动的 … linux下启动tomcat服务的命令是什么...… Windows7中启动Mysql服务时提示:拒绝访问的一种解决方式 场景 在Windows7中打开任务管理器–服务下 找到mysql的服务点击启动时提示: 拒绝访问 这是因为权限不够导致的不能启动...文件配置出错了, 你可以删除系统目录下的my.ini文件, 把下面的内容重新写入my.ini文件试试, 要适当地改 … Linux下将MySQL服务添加到服务器的系统服务中 Linux下将MySQL服务添加到服务器的系统服务中...Linux环境下将MySQL服务添加到服务器的系统服务中 1.了解MySQL程序路径 MySQL数据目录: /home/mysql/dataMyS … 命令行启动mysql服务 在课程中曾学过net命令...,可以用于启动后台服务.在mysql中,net命令用于启动后台服务器进程mysqld,即后台服务.

    20.1K30

    linux命令mysql启动,linux中mysql启动服务命令

    大家好,又见面了,我是你们的朋友全栈君。 Linux下使用相关命令可以直接启动mysql服务,下面由学习啦小编为大家整理了linux下mysql启动服务命令的相关知识,希望对大家有帮助!...linux的mysql启动服务命令 linux的mysql启动服务命令1:使用mysqld启动、关闭MySQL服务 mysqld是MySQL的守护进程,我们可以用mysqld来启动、关闭MySQL服务,...启动服务命令2:使用mysqld_safe启动、关闭MySQL服务 很多时候,人们会纠结mysqld与mysqld_safe的区别....其实mysqld_safe是一个脚本,一个非常安全的启动、关闭MySQL服务的脚本。它实际上也是调用mysqld来启动、关闭MySQL服务。...启动服务命令4:使用mysqld_multi启动、关闭MySQL服务 当服务器上运行了多个MySQL实例时,mysqld_multi是一个非常棒的管理MySQL服务器的工具。

    46.3K50

    MySQL在Consul服务中的健康检查逻辑

    这是学习笔记的第 2090 篇文章 MySQL的Consul方向开始要大规模推广的时候,一直感觉健康检查的部分还是不够严谨,虽然感觉是,但是总体逻辑上看也没什么硬伤,就暂时搁置了下来,最近业务的推广和普及...在Consul服务中,健康检查的逻辑应该是DBA侧集成最重要的一个环节了,总体来说,有两类需求,一类是数据写入,一类是读写分离,对于这两个类别,读写分离的部分有点特别,可以拆分成两个场景,第一个场景是只在从库可读...要实现这个功能,我们需要首先理清楚第一个概念,数据库的角色怎么判断,数据库的角色在这里我取舍了Relay的状况(Relay目前不适合Consul服务注册),把角色分为了Master,Slave和Error...有了第一层的保证,第二层的域名服务注册就会容易一些,这里我分为了选项Check_option,如果数据库角色为Master并且Check_Option为Write则提示写域名注册成功,否则为失败。...个人新书 《MySQL DBA工作笔记》

    1.2K10

    Arcgis Server服务中rest服务和wms服务的对应关系

    概述: 我们在用Arcgis Server发布服务时,会发布Mapserver的同时发布Wmsserver服务,但是,调用的图层的顺序却相反,本文从几个例子详细介绍下rest服务和wms服务的对应关系...示例: 1、无分支的情况 REST WMS mapserver layer1 0 4 layer2 1 3 layer3 2 2 layer4 3 1 layer5 4 0 说明:...在无分支的情况下,rest和wms的图层顺序刚好相反。...2、有分支的情况 REST WMS mapserver layer1 0 5 layer2 1 2 layer21 2 4 layer22 3 3 layer3 4 1...,rest和wms的图层顺序号也是相反的,但是先顺的是父节点的图层,其实在有分支的情况下,父节点的图层wms是没有图层号的,但是子节点的图层号的规律如上两表所示。

    1.3K51

    Chris Richardson微服务翻译:微服务架构中的服务发现

    传统运行在物理机上的应用,服务实例的网络地址一般是静态的,可以从配置文件中去读取地址。 对于基于云平台的微服务中,有更多如下的问题需要解决: ? 服务实例的网络地址是动态分配的。...代理可以根据 IP地址和端口 来路由客户端请求,透明的将客户端的请求转发到集群中某个可用的服务实例上。...客户端能缓存从服务注册表中获取的网络地址,然而这些信息最终会过时,客户端也不能再根据该信息发现服务实例。因此,服务注册表对集群中的实例使用复制协议来保证一致性。...不足:除非内置在部署环境中,不然又是一个需要被维护和管理的高可用组件。 总结 微服务应用中,服务实例的网络地址会动态的变化,因此,为了使客户端能够向服务端发起请求,必须有服务发现机制。...使用客户端发现的系统中,客户端直接查询注册表,选择一个可用实例发起请求;在服务端发现的系统中,客户端通过路由转发请求,路由会查询服务注册表并将请求转发到可用服务实例上。

    93690

    SpringCloud微服务实战(四)-微服务中的服务拆分

    商品服务模块全部源码 https://github.com/Wasabi1234/productdemo 4.1 微服务拆分的起点 4.2 康威定律和微服务 沟通的问题会影响系统的设计 4.3 点餐业务服务拆分分析...4.4 商品服务API和SQL介绍 4.5 商品服务编码实战(上) 在 IDEA 中新建项目 项目初始化 pom 文件 为启动类添加该注解 基本配置信息 启动该类,将此服务注册到 eureka 上去...添加所需依赖 业务需求 配置数据库相关信息 添加 lombok 依赖 编写dto类 开始单元测试 编写测试类 必须要有此二注解,否则空指针异常 测试通过 开始编码第二个功能 测试通过 4.6 商品服务编码实战...(中) 编写service 层 编码技巧,测试类可以直接继承启动类的测试类,减少注解个数,做到了最大可能的解耦 编写 vo 包下的类 4.7 商品服务编码实战(下) 完成 controller 类 启动程序...优化返回值 4.8 订单服务API和sql介绍 业务需求 4.9 订单服务dao 启动 配置数据库信息并正常启动 save数据成功 4.10 订单服务service 4.11 订单服务controller

    4.1K60

    刚刚购买的云服务-MySQL

    看看这次的腾讯云如何? 这次的云服务只是MySQL 最基础版。请上传 JPG/PNG 图片文件,大小 200KB 以内,这些限制为什么不早说!...------------------ 推荐于2017-11-19 00:07:35 最佳答案 200K,即200KB,是照片存储所占空间,而不是照片的像素多少,也不能决定照片的宽高,JPG照片的像素数与存储大小不能换算...qbl=relate_question_0 ================ 据资料记载,1958年,生活在这里的纳瓦霍部落印第安人建立了这个公园,将这里的一座座纪念碑,按岩石所处的不同侵蚀阶段,分为三种...,一种叫平顶山(Mesa),岩石处于侵蚀的第一阶段,比较宽大平坦,例如雨神山;一种叫孤丘(Butte),从平顶山进入侵蚀的第二阶段,岩石形状较小,例如东西拇指手套;最后一种叫塔(Spire),从孤丘进入侵蚀的第三阶段...,岩石形成后变得狭窄并可自由耸立,经过风雨的冲刷洗礼后,只有底部能承受砂岩的岩石才得以傲立在荒漠上,例如三姐妹和图腾柱。

    3.4K51

    phpstudy8在windows2016上安装后在服务列表找不到服务

    phpstudy8在windows2016上安装后在服务列表找不到服务 phpstudy最新版用了mysql8.0,安装之前先安装VC库http://www.pc6.com/softview/SoftView..._104246.html 然后安装后设置开机启动,设置后发现运行services.msc服务列表里是没有web服务(apache或nginx)和mysql服务的,只有filezilla server;查看...Menu\Programs\Startup没有开机启动项,运行msconfig也没找到开机启动项 最后通过安装AnVir Task Manager Free 看到phpStudyServer是通过注册表设置的开机启动项...,是一个打包服务,包含了Web服务和数据库服务 注册表路径是H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Windows\CurrentVersion\Run image.png...同样的软件在2008 R2里安装后执行msconfig是可以看到有开机启动项的 image.png 综上,以后看开机启动项的时候,从4个维度 1、services.msc 2、msconfig 3、注册表

    2.6K20

    Docker搭建MySQL服务

    为什么80%的码农都做不了架构师?>>> ? Docker开源镜像 前面我们已经安装好了Docker,也简单了解了Docker。那么我们可以尝试搭建一个MySQL服务。...要搭建服务就要启动服务容器,要创建容易就要有镜像,Docker提供了一个类似Github的开源平台,提供开源镜像,放心可靠。...–name:给新创建的容器命名,此处命名为pwc-mysql -e:配置信息,此处配置mysql的root用户的登陆密码 -p:端口映射,此处映射主机3306端口到容器pwc-mysql的3306端口...连接成功,也可以进行相关数据库操作,因此MySQL服务搭建成功!...---- 其他 1.可以启动多个MySQL服务,因为我们启动的是容器,容器可以有多个,只要容器名字映射段端口不一样就可以了,例如: $ sudo docker run --name dbdb -e MYSQL_ROOT_PASSWORD

    2K10

    微服务架构中的服务注册与发现

    另外,需要定义服务提供者与注册中心之间的通信协议,如RESTful API、gRPC或Thrift,以实现高效、稳定的数据传输。服务健康检查:在微服务架构中,服务实例的数量和网络地址都是动态变化的。...**高可用/分布式:**如果服务注册中心发生故障,可能会导致整个系统的服务发现功能失效。在分布式架构中,CAP理论(一致性、可用性、分区容错性)提供了一个理论框架来指导服务注册与发现的设计。...这通常可以通过使用高效的数据查询算法,如哈希查找或者树形查找等来实现。负载均衡:在多个相同的服务实例中,服务发现机制需要能够选择一个合适的实例进行调用。...基于DNSDNS(域名系统)也可以用于服务注册与发现。在Kubernetes(简称K8S)云原生环境中,基于DNS的服务注册与发现是一种非常实用且广泛采用的机制。...易于集成:由于DNS的通用性,基于DNS的服务发现可以快速集成到现有的系统中,降低了实现成本。缺点: 性能要求:独立DNS服务器模式对DNS服务器的性能要求较高,特别是在高并发场景下。

    2.1K11

    微服务中的短信服务如何设计?

    发送短信功能,在开发过程中是最常见的需求。用户登录验证码的发送,活动促销短信的发送等。...本Chat将带领你深入的去学习如何设计和实现一个通用的基础短信服务,采用Spring Boot开发短信服务,最终会注册到Spring Cloud微服务体系中,方便其他服务使用。...主要内容如下: 短信服务的需求 阿里云短信的接入 短信服务的设计 短信API的管理 短信的安全防护 短信的监控 异步发送和同步发送 整合到Spring Cloud中 学完本 Chat 后将掌握使用 Spring...Boot 设计并开发一个微服务体系下的短信基础服务。...这是我第一次写Chat,跟写书相比,Chat的优势在于内容专注于某一点的解决方案,周期也比较短。不管写的好不好,都要给自己一点鼓励。一点点探索,一点点尝试,你就慢慢进步了。

    2.5K20
    领券